diff --git a/src/init.lua b/src/init.lua
index 7fbdb55fe8457a302f1f727d8db6d163d29b2ecb..0f4ca051592e55a97794b635c2c198c8e22a0e22 100644
--- a/src/init.lua
+++ b/src/init.lua
@@ -1,16 +1,13 @@
 vim.g.mapleader = ","
 
--- Plugins
-require('plugins')
-
 -- Options
 require('options')
 
 -- Mappings
 require('mappings')
 
--- Color theme
---vim.api.nvim_command("colorscheme tokyonight")
+-- Plugins
+require('plugins')
 
 -- Misc
 vim.api.nvim_command("syntax on")
diff --git a/src/lua/config/tokyonight.lua b/src/lua/config/tokyonight.lua
index 663825cdcf5d9ae42ea18222e031a453721beffb..f1f37e9cb3ab051a61b1f459a48c68273445f4e8 100644
--- a/src/lua/config/tokyonight.lua
+++ b/src/lua/config/tokyonight.lua
@@ -1,8 +1,10 @@
 return function()
   local tokyonight = require('tokyonight')
 
+  vim.api.nvim_command("colorscheme tokyonight-moon")
+
   tokyonight.setup({
-    style = "storm",
+    style = "moon",
     --transparent = true,
     styles = {
       sidebars = "dark",
@@ -12,6 +14,4 @@ return function()
     lualine_bold = true,
     use_background = false,
   })
-
-  vim.api.nvim_command("colorscheme tokyonight-moon")
 end
diff --git a/src/lua/plugins.lua b/src/lua/plugins.lua
index 5679d0c09f9c42ac92efcd73ee28e8ff5d38fcc9..322a6e46ef296938be47f0ff2861d2ce05566a54 100644
--- a/src/lua/plugins.lua
+++ b/src/lua/plugins.lua
@@ -37,6 +37,8 @@ require('lazy').setup({
   { "folke/lazy.nvim", enabled = false },
   {
     'folke/tokyonight.nvim',
+    lazy = false;
+    priority = 1000;
     config = require('config.tokyonight'),
   },
   {